@charset "utf-8";
/* CSS Document */
/*1200px 块*/
.yy_ad,.logo,.newscenter{width: 1200px; height: auto; overflow: hidden;margin: 0 auto;}
li a:hover{color: #2c73ac;}
/******眼遇img*******/
.head{width: 100%; height: auto; overflow: hidden; background-color: #F3F3F3;}
.yy_ad{margin: 5px auto;}
.logo{margin-top: 30px; line-height: 40px; margin-bottom: 30px;}
.logo a{color: #676F62; font-size: 16px;}
#siteSearch{float: right;width: 422px; height: 41px;font-size: 14px;cursor: pointer;padding-top: 7px;}
#soform{width: 422px ; height: 39px; border: 1px solid #2C72AD;}
#kw,.btn1{line-height:37px;}
.btn1{width: 70px; height:100%; text-align: center;padding: 0 21px; background-color: #2C72AD;color: #fff; float: right;}
.input1{width: 340px; padding-left: 10px;height: 37px; }
/*面包屑*/
.mbx{float: left;}
.mbx a{background: url(../images/mbx.png) no-repeat right center; padding-right: 20px;}
.logo img{float: left;}
/*新闻细览*/
.newscenter{padding: 15px 0;margin-top: 20px;  }
.time_source{width: 100%;height: auto;overflow: hidden;}
.newsleft{width: 730px; height: auto; overflow: hidden; border-right: 1px solid #E4E4E4; float: left; text-align: justify; padding-right:40px;}
.newsleft h1{text-align: left;}
#share{width: 100%;height: 49px; background: url(../images/sharebg.gif) no-repeat left -2px; margin-top: 30px;margin-bottom: 20px; border-top: 1px dashed #E7E7E7;border-bottom: 1px dashed #E7E7E7;}
.time,.source{ font-size: 13px; color: #BEBEBF;margin-right: 30px;}
#share ul{width: 90%;height: 49px; padding-left: 65px;}
#share li{width: 95px; height: 100%; float: left; margin-right: 10px;}
#share li a{width: 100%; height: 100%;display: inline-block; cursor: pointer;background: none;}
.newscontent{height: auto;padding: 20px 0;}
.newscontent a{color: #0000ff;}
.newscontent div{ height: auto !important; overflow-y: inherit !important; }
.newscontent p{margin-bottom: 15px;line-height: 28px; font-size: 16px;text-indent: 2em;}
.newscontent h1,.newscontent h2,.newscontent h3,.newscontent h4,.newscontent h5,.newscontent h6{font-size: 16px;}
.newscontent img{max-width: 710px;height: auto!important;}
.article-tags{background: #F7F9F7;color: #8F8F8F;clear: both;font-size: 14px; height: 33px; padding: 5px 0 5px 5px;display: none;}
.article-tags span{height: 20px; display: inline-block;}
.teag-lists{display: block;width: 570px; height: 34px;}
.teag-lists a{display: block;padding: 2px 15px;margin: 0 5px;float: left;color: #ffffff;}
.tags0{background: #48A1F7 url(../images/1.png) left no-repeat;padding-left: 16px;}
.tags1{background: #74BF68 url(../images/2.png) left no-repeat;padding-left: 16px;}
.tags2{background: #EBB128 url(../images/3.png) left no-repeat;padding-left: 16px;}
.newscontent .editor {color: #999; font-size: 14px;}
.chatdiv{width: 700px;}
#chatdiv{ display: none; }
/*推荐阅读*/
.tjyd{width: 100%;height: auto; overflow: hidden;margin-top: 15px;}
.tjyd_p{width:100%; font-size: 18px;color: #000000; border-bottom: 4px solid #B6B6B6; display: inline-block;}
.tjnews{width:100%;height: auto; overflow: hidden; border-bottom: 1px solid #F5F5F5; padding-bottom: 20px;}
.tjnews:last-of-type{border: none;}
.tjnews_left{width: 160px;height: 88px;}
.tjnews_left img{width: 145px; height: 88px;}
.tjnews_right{width: 500px;}
.right_p1{font-size: 18px;}
.right_p2{margin-top: 20px; color: #9D9B9C;}
/*精彩图片*/
.jcimg{width: 100%;height: auto;overflow: hidden;}
.jcnews li{width: 219px;height: auto; overflow: hidden; float: left; margin-right: 10px; margin-bottom: 26px; position: relative;}
.jcnews li img{width: 219px; height: 154px;}
.jcnews li p{position: absolute; bottom: 0; left: 0; text-align: center;width: 219px; height: 32px; line-height: 32px; color: #FFFFFF; font-size: 14px; background: url(../images/p-bg.png) repeat-x center;}
/*更多新闻*/
.morenewsdiv{width: 100%;height: auto;overflow: hidden;}
.morenewsleft{width: 220px;height: 100%;}
.morenewsleft img{width: 220px;height: 155px;}
.morenewsleft li{position: relative;width: 220px;height: 155px;}
.morenewsleft a{display: inline-block; }
.morenewsleft p{position: absolute;bottom: 0;left: 0;text-align: center;width: 220px;height: 32px;line-height: 32px;color: #FFFFFF;font-size: 14px;background: url(../images/p-bg.png) repeat-x center;}
.morenewsright{width: 435px;height: 100%;}
.morenewsright li{background: url(../images/dian.png) no-repeat left center; padding-left: 10px; white-space: nowrap;}
.morenewsright li a{line-height: 35px; font-size: 16px; color:#333333;}
.morenewsright .toutiaob a{font-size: 20px;line-height: 30px;font-weight: bold;height: 30px;}
/*底部广告*/
.btmad{width: 705px;height: 100px; overflow: hidden;}
.btmad img{width: 705px; height: 100px;}
/*新闻右侧部分*/
.page_active{background-color: #4693D1; color: #FFFFFF;}
.newsright{width: 422px; height: auto; overflow: hidden; float: right; font-size: 16px;}
.first_ad,.secondad,.thirdad{width: 422px; height: auto; overflow: hidden; text-align: center; margin-bottom: 20px;}
.first_ad img{width: 422px; height: 345px;}
.secondad img{width: 422px; height: 345px;}
.thirdad img{width: 422px; height: 540px;}
.yy_lt_adiv{width: 100%; height: 34px;background: url(../images/title-bg.png) no-repeat left bottom;font-size: 18px; padding-bottom: 10px; line-height: 20px; }
.yy_lt_a,.yy_lt_a2 {height: 34px; display: block;color: #333333; font-size: 20px; display: inline-block; float: left;}
.yy_lt_a3{float: right; line-height: 20px; font-size: 16px; color: #969A9B;}
.yy_lt_a  span:last-of-type{color: #969A9B;font-size: 16px; display: inline-block;  line-height: 35px;}
.yy_lt dl{width: 205px;  margin-top: 20px;}
.yy_lt dl img{width: 205px; height: 130px;}
.yy_lt dd{margin-top: 5px; text-align: center;}
.yy_lt ul{width: 100%;height: auto; overflow: hidden; padding-top: 10px; }
.yy_lt li{background: url(../images/dian.png) no-repeat left center; line-height: 40px; padding-left: 15px;}
.pdjx_ad .pdjx_ad_a{height: 34px; font-size: 18px; background: url(../images/title-bg.png) no-repeat left bottom;padding-bottom: 10px; display: block;}
.pdjx_ad_a  span{color: #333333; font-size: 20px; display: inline-block;line-height: 35px;}
/*.pdjx_ad_a  span:last-of-type{color: #969A9B;font-size: 16px; display: inline-block;  line-height: 35px;}*/
.pdjx_ad dl{height: 260px;  margin-top: 20px;}
.pdjx_ad dl img{width: 422px;height: 260px;}
.pdjx_ad ul{width: 100%;height: auto; overflow: hidden; padding-top: 10px; }
.pdjx_ad li{background: url(../images/dian.png) no-repeat left center; line-height: 40px; padding-left: 15px;}
.pdjx_ad a{color: #676F62;}
.xx_zx .xx_zx_a{height: 34px;font-size: 18px;width: 100%; background: url(../images/title-bg.png) no-repeat left bottom;padding-bottom: 10px; display: block;}
.xx_zx_a  span:first-of-type{color: #333333; font-size: 20px; display: inline-block;  line-height: 35px;}
.xx_zx_a  span:last-of-type{color: #969A9B;font-size: 16px; display: inline-block;  line-height: 35px;}
.xx_zx dl{width: 50%;  text-align: center; margin-top: 20px;}
.xx_zx ul{width: 100%;height: auto; overflow: hidden; padding-top: 10px; background:url(../images/numbg.png) no-repeat 0px 0px;}
.xx_zx li{line-height: 40px; padding-left: 35px;}
.xx_zx a{color: #676F62;display: block;white-space: nowrap;text-overflow: ellipsis;width: 395px;overflow: hidden;}
.xx_zx li span{width: 25px; height: 25px; border-radius:50% ; display: inline-block; text-align: center; vertical-align: middle; line-height: 25px; margin-right: 7px; }
.libgcolor{background-color: #CBC7AE; color: #FFFFFF;}

span.sMore i{ float: left;margin-left: 10px; font-style: normal; }
#siteRankClip{ height: 330px;overflow: hidden;  }